In the UK, Ireland, Greece, Italy, and Romania, UFC has partnered with NetBet, designating the gaming site as its Official Sportsbook and Betting Partner. In important European markets, this strategic alliance will result in more betting possibilities and improved fan interaction.
The partnership begins on March 22nd at The O2 in London with UFC FIGHT NIGHT: EDWARDS vs. BRADY. During live events, NetBet will have prominent visibility inside the Octagon® as part of the arrangement. NetBet’s branding will also be visible to fans who watch UFC’s global broadcast feed and interact on digital and social media platforms.
Nicholas Smith, TKO Senior Vice President and Head of International Business, highlighted the significance of the deal. “As UFC continues to grow and expand across Europe, it’s great to bring on such a reputable betting partner who already has a strong, established UFC fanbase,” he said. “We couldn’t be kicking it off at a better time than with UFC FIGHT NIGHT: EDWARDS vs. BRADY, our marquee event this year in London, UK.”
This partnership enhances UFC’s expansion into the European market while giving NetBet a platform to connect with MMA enthusiasts. NetBet CEO Marcel Prioteasa expressed his excitement, saying, “We are excited to become the European betting partner of UFC, uniting the adrenaline-pumping action of the world’s premier mixed martial arts organization with the elite betting experience our customers expect.”
